Output 58cf185ceeb8c9b6f251ee0d5159c987041f68ec33c0f4e2be44e37112c251fa:0

value
44064012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f61daeb3b68100f14c58eb5548fde9490416663 OP_EQUAL
address
MRM6XAX8TmHCuaGYooFKraTTgEo6AEnWki
transaction
58cf185ceeb8c9b6f251ee0d5159c987041f68ec33c0f4e2be44e37112c251fa
spent
true